Convert grayscale image to normal map in Nuke?

Does anyone know how you could convert a grayscale hightmap image into a normals pass using nuke? I want to then use the normals on a relighting tool. This would basically allow me to have a really nice emboss in nuke that gives much more control than the built in emboss.

Basically you would have to compute vectors based on gradients in the image. At first I thought maybe a matrix filter could be used to create a hacked normal map.. but I just don’t know enough about it to make it happen.
